The Winton Woods High School graduation ceremony held on May 13, 2025, marked a significant milestone for the graduating class, with 14 students achieving not only their high school diplomas but also associate degrees from Miami University through the Early College Academy program. This partnership highlights the district's commitment to providing advanced educational opportunities and fostering academic excellence among its students.
During the ceremony, school officials, including Superintendent Denny and School Board President Smith, certified the graduates, affirming that they had met all state and district requirements for graduation. This formal recognition underscores the importance of educational standards and the dedication of both students and educators in achieving academic success.
The event celebrated the achievements of a diverse group of graduates, with a total of 118 names announced as they received their diplomas.
